We are seeking a detail-oriented and proactive BIM Technician to join our design team.
In this role, you will be responsible for producing high-quality technical drawings and BIM models, with a strong focus on electrical systems and infrastructure.
This position offers the opportunity to work on complex, large-scale projects, including data centres and high-performance facilities.
You'll work closely with engineers, project managers, and installation teams to deliver accurate, coordinated, and standards-compliant BIM outputs from concept through to construction and as-built phases.
Major Responsibilities
Develop and maintain detailed 2D and 3D models using Revit (MEP focus) and AutoCAD.
Interpret mark-ups and design changes to update drawings accordingly.
Generate and maintain drawings and models for tender, construction, and installation phases.
Translate hand sketches and engineering concepts into production-level drawings.
Support compliance with QA/QC standards, BIM execution plans, and documentation requirements.
Collaborate with cross-functional teams including engineering, sales, and site installation crews.
Produce as-built documentation by working closely with installation engineers.
Coordinate with external stakeholders and assist in clash detection, drawing review, and issue resolution.
Take ownership of specific project design elements, ensuring timely delivery to project milestones.
Ensure that all outputs meet internal and client design standards.

Technical Skills
Proficiency in Autodesk Revit (preferably MEP) and AutoCAD.
Strong working knowledge of Microsoft Office Suite (Excel, Word, Outlook).
Experience with BIM 360, Navisworks, or similar model coordination platforms (advantageous).
Familiarity with Bluebeam Revu for markup and drawing review (a plus).
Solid understanding of BIM workflows and drawing standards (e.g., ISO 19650 desirable).
Key Qualities
Minimum of 3 years' experience in a design environment.
Previous work in the construction industry is required; experience in data centre construction is a strong advantage.
Ability to read and interpret technical drawings, schematics, and specifications.
Background in electrical design, security systems, or infrastructure design preferred.
